There are many reasons to believe that procrastination has a negative ...Feb 14, 2023 · The fear of failure and inadequacy causes procrastination. This in turn causes you to be even more anxious and perfectionistic. Procrastination, perfectionism, and anxiety start to form a vicious cycle that loops around endlessly. As a perfectionist procrastinator, you want to avoid judgment and criticism from others – and from yourself most ...

However, procrastination can become chronic and habitual. You are constantly putting things off until there is a cumulative effect. The more you must do, or the more you don’t like what you must do, the more you procrastinate. Procrastination becomes a vicious cycle: you become overwhelmed with what must be done and the lack of time left to ...
